Output d8685775af1aaaa1afe3ef8f21a22d496898c77c77ec40de2f31beb5e67e494b:2

value
498707940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af07b58553798fcf8bc3c4e267da897bcac80fa OP_EQUAL
address
374fCe3Qgcsxjn5uYj9Wvc2Sa5ekA4wgNs
transaction
d8685775af1aaaa1afe3ef8f21a22d496898c77c77ec40de2f31beb5e67e494b
spent
true